Honesty is an important characteristic to have as a leader. Great leaders are also trustworthy leader. As you build your leadership skills, try working on honesty and trustworthiness. When people believe that they can rely on your word, they will also respect you more as their leader.

Avoid actions that are deceitful or devious. For a good leader to build trust, come through with promises. If you boast about the great service your company provides, then be sure that everyone working for you recognizes what they need to do in order to provide it.

Always keep communication open with your employees. Be sure they know of any news and changes in plans. Failing to let people know all pertinent information is counterproductive and can only hurt the team's goals. Not communicating well also makes you appear aloof and incompetent.

Don't lose your moral compass. Make sure you will be able to live with your decisions. Don't make a decision that will leave you upset or guilty. Some people might have different morals from yours, but you must follow your own conscience.

When someone does good work, provide them with rewards. Sure, everyone is getting paid, but an incentive can be a great motivational tool. When an employee makes an extra effort, let them know you notice and encourage them with a reward. Top leaders don't penny pinch on this.

Learn to listen. Being a great leader starts with listening to what your team has to say. Listen to what your workers are saying. Listen to their praise, but listen to their complaints as well. Pay attention to their feedback when it comes to the buyers and the products. You may be surprised at the amount of things you learn from just listening to others.

Make sure you hire people who will advance your business goals. Preferably, this means people who are smart, can solve problems, and most importantly, have some experience in your business field. Make sure you check references and do proper research so that you don't get scammed by someone with a fake resume and a silver tongue.
